HEALTH AND FITNESS
Mesh organizations that offer health and fitness programs focus on how to leverage the power of community to deliver benefits to members. Cooperative health insurance providers, for instance, use their group buying power to help members get the coverage they need at an affordable price. Members of community sports clubs gain access to both scheduled group exercise and a variety of other events through the clubs’ social networks.
Aire is an urban performance cooperative of highly experienced athletic and wellness experts who help members accomplish their fitness-related goals. The San Diego-based co-op offers private and group Pilates, cycling, rowing, and TRX classes, as well as access to personal trainers. And as a testament to its community ethos, Aire does not require a membership fee. Instead, members pay Aire trainers directly for their instruction and classes.
